Tanya Sheckley is an Entrepreneur, Founder of UP Academy and Co-Founder of Project UP. UP Academy is a non-traditional elementary school which values respect, innovation, empathy and strength. Project UP brings a fully integrated Literacy and project based learning curriculum for K-5 schools as well as building a community of founders and leaders. Tanya’s vision and mission show it’s possible to celebrate differences, change what’s broken in the American education system, and that all children can receive a rigorous, well rounded education. She is author of Rebel Educator’s podcast and book, Create Classrooms of Imagination and Impact. Speaking frequently on the future of education and entrepreneurship, Tanya works with founders and leaders to launch innovative school models, question the status quo, and develop engaging student experiences through inclusion and project based learning.
